A few other observations:
- Tridel is working on foundation work for Ultra Ovation
- The crane for Eve is now up
- The sales office for Absolute is completely gone
- The Chicago sales office is being renovated ahead of the launch
- No activity at the Parkside sales office site (exterior complete, though)
- Tuscany Gates, on Eglinton, is rising fast (at least 10 floors done)
- The City has erected "pay and display parking coming fall 07" signs at all on-street parking areas
- A new 8000 sq ft 'flagship' Spring Rolls is U/C at the Sussex Centre in what I believe was the old Lime Rickey's (since then, it's been non-retail office uses). That should really make a positive improvement to the street life in that area (they are building a large patio as well).
- The Confederation Pkwy 'gateway' bridge is under construction
